The Latest on Missouri's Cannabis Beverages

Missouri has recently launched its cannabis beverage market, providing a wide variety of drinks for consumers. However, understanding the regulations surrounding these beverages is important.

  • Cannabis-infused beverages in Missouri must contain no exceeding 10 milligrams of THC per serving.
  • Moreover, manufacturers are required to precisely indicate the THC content on each product.
  • Sales of cannabis beverages are subject to specific rules state law and can only occur at designated cannabis stores

For consumers, it's advisable to pay attention to THC content before purchasing a cannabis beverage.
